Abstract
Shape is one of the most important features in Content Based Image Retrieval (CBIR). When a shape is used as feature, edge detection might be the first step of feature extraction. Invariance to the different transformations like translation, rotation, and scale is required by a good shape representation. In this paper a performance comparison is done on various image transforms like Wavelet transform, Fourier transform, Haar transform, Walsh-Hadamard transform and discrete cosine transform using a fuzzy similarity measure. It is seen that according to retrieval performance Wavelet transform gives the best result among the other mentioned transforms. It has higher recall and precision values and higher crossover point.
